如何解决AI语音开发中的噪音问题?

在人工智能的浪潮中,语音识别技术作为人机交互的重要途径,已经逐渐深入到我们的日常生活。然而,在AI语音开发过程中,噪音问题一直是一个难以逾越的难题。今天,就让我们通过一个人的故事,来探讨如何解决AI语音开发中的噪音问题。

李明,一位年轻的AI语音技术工程师,自从接触语音识别领域以来,就对噪音问题产生了浓厚的兴趣。他深知,噪音是影响语音识别准确率的重要因素,如果不能有效解决噪音问题,那么AI语音技术将无法得到广泛应用。

李明所在的团队负责开发一款面向大众的智能语音助手,这款助手需要在各种复杂环境下稳定工作。然而,现实环境中的噪音问题让语音助手的表现并不理想。在一次团队讨论中,李明提出了一个大胆的想法:通过收集海量噪音数据,训练一个能够识别和过滤噪音的模型。

为了实现这个想法,李明和他的团队开始了艰苦的探索。他们首先收集了大量的噪音数据,包括交通噪音、工厂噪音、家庭噪音等。这些数据通过不同的采集设备,从不同的角度、不同的时间段进行采集,力求全面覆盖各种噪音场景。

接着,李明团队对收集到的噪音数据进行了预处理,包括降噪、去噪等操作,确保数据质量。随后,他们使用深度学习技术,设计了一个能够自动学习噪音特征的神经网络模型。这个模型通过不断训练,逐渐掌握了噪音的规律,能够在语音信号中识别并过滤掉噪音。

然而,在模型训练过程中,李明遇到了一个难题:噪音种类繁多,且具有很强的随机性。为了解决这一问题,他尝试了多种方法,包括:

  1. 数据增强:通过对噪音数据进行旋转、缩放、翻转等操作,增加数据多样性,提高模型的泛化能力。

  2. 多任务学习:将噪音识别与语音识别任务结合起来,让模型在处理语音信号的同时,学习如何过滤噪音。

  3. 对抗训练:设计对抗样本,让模型在训练过程中不断学习如何识别和抵御噪音干扰。

经过几个月的努力,李明团队终于训练出了一个能够有效识别和过滤噪音的模型。在实验中,这个模型在多种噪音环境下都取得了令人满意的效果。他们将这个模型应用到智能语音助手中,使得语音助手在噪音环境下的表现得到了显著提升。

然而,李明并没有满足于此。他意识到,噪音问题是一个复杂的系统问题,需要从多个角度进行解决。于是,他开始研究如何将噪音问题与其他技术相结合,以实现更全面的解决方案。

首先,李明团队将噪音识别模型与麦克风阵列技术相结合。通过多个麦克风收集声音信号,然后利用空间滤波算法,对声音进行预处理,从而降低噪音对语音信号的影响。

其次,他们研究了环境自适应技术。通过分析环境噪音特征,智能语音助手可以自动调整参数,以适应不同的噪音环境。例如,在嘈杂的街道上,助手会自动提高音量,降低噪音干扰。

最后,李明团队还尝试了云降噪技术。通过将语音信号传输到云端,利用强大的计算能力,对语音信号进行降噪处理,然后将降噪后的信号传输回终端设备。

经过一系列的技术创新,李明团队成功解决了AI语音开发中的噪音问题。他们的智能语音助手在市场上的表现也日益出色,得到了广大用户的认可。

李明的成功故事告诉我们,解决AI语音开发中的噪音问题需要多方面的努力。首先,要收集和预处理海量噪音数据,为模型训练提供有力支持。其次,要不断优化模型,提高其识别和过滤噪音的能力。最后,要将噪音问题与其他技术相结合,实现更全面的解决方案。

在人工智能发展的道路上,噪音问题是我们必须面对的挑战。相信通过像李明这样的技术人员的努力,我们一定能够克服这一难题,让AI语音技术更好地服务于我们的生活。

猜你喜欢:AI陪聊软件